Classic of science (and mathematical) fiction ? charmingly illustrated by author ? describes the journeys of A. Square and his adventures in Spaceland (three
dimensions
), Lineland (one dimension) and Pointland (no dimensions). A. Square also entertains thoughts of visiting a land of four dimensions ? a revolutionary idea for which he is banished from Spaceland.

Understand Multi-Dimensional Worlds
This book is often recommend by theoretical physicists and mathematicians (most often mathematicians involved in hyperdimensional topology) to their students.
It was written by a Shakespeare scholar in Britain more than 100 years ago. The reason it is recommended by theoretical physicists, etc., is it provides the reader with a framework for understanding and trying to visualize
dimensions
above or beyond our ordinary four-dimensional world (length, width, heighth, space-time).
It deals with a two dimensional world with two dimensional beings and what happens when a third dimensional being interacts with a two dimensional world and what the two dimensional beings would see. It also does this in terms of a one dimensional being and one dimensional world interacting with a two dimensional world and two dimensional beings (or structures).
This book written with apparently some intent on commenting on Victorian England and its values (with what appeared to me to have some misogynistic comments within it), was otherwise an enjoyable book and really does provide a good analysis on multi-dimensional view points and visualizing or imagining hyper-dimensions.
If you are interested in advanced theoretical physics, hyperdimensional geometry or topology or mathematics, this is a very interesting book and may be useful. If you are just interested in a good unique science fiction story, I would highly recommend this. This is not an (explicit) math or science book - so you won't find any explicit mathematics (i.e., no math is required).

A 2D and 4D Classic Text
Originally written with a Victorian theme, it is now a must-read classic for anyone who enjoys reading about the fourth dimension. The story is about a two-dimensional being (called A Square) living in a two-dimensional world (hence the title,
Flatland
). As a three-dimensional being imagining this two-dimensional world, you come to realize that you can understand higher-dimensional space through lower-dimensional analogies. In fact, A Square meets a three-dimensional being (A Sphere), and takes a journey beyond the second dimension. Although some readers may enjoy the book for its historical and Victorian period merits, math lovers can enjoy the book for its geometric insight.
